spark plug valley cover removal
 
what size are the allen key that holds this down? i dont have one big enough so i need the size to buy one, short of trying them in the parking lot

btwilson86 11-13-2010 10:15 AM

Don't have my tool with me, but I'm pretty sure it's a 14mm

Bill UK 11-13-2010 11:04 AM

Correct btwilson86, it just so happens to be the same hex size as the engine sump drain plug, but obviously internal instead of external.
